Berkeley, California (preferred) or London, UK About the Organization MATS finds and trains talented individuals for what we see as the world's most urgent and talent‑constrained problem: reducing risks from unaligned artificial intelligence. We believe ambitious researchers from a variety of backgrounds have the potential to meaningfully contribute to alignment, control, security, and governance research. Through our research fellowship, we provide mentorship, training, professional network, and financial support to accelerate their careers and increase their impact. Since 2021, we have trained over 446 researchers. 80% now work in AI alignment. 10% have co‑founded organizations. Our fellows have produced 170+ research papers with 9,500+ citations. What You’ll Do Develop the process architecture: MATS has a recruiting process, but it was designed for a smaller organization and it won’t scale to the growth ahead. You will assess what we have, identify gaps, and build something more durable. That means working with a formal applicant tracking system, designing repeatable workflows for sourcing, screening, and closing candidates, and documenting the process so it can be handed off, delegated, or expanded as the team grows. You’ll act as manager, implementor, and recruiter — often in the same week. Find the right people: MATS aims to double its size by filling 40+ full‑time positions over the next year, many of them new, unusual, and/or highly technical roles. As our (Senior) Recruiting Lead, you will do full‑cycle recruiting. You will draft these job descriptions, find appropriate places to advertise for candidates, screen out unqualified candidates, and design effective interview questions, rubrics, and work tests for MATS to use to assess candidates. Run a rigorous, fast hiring process: You will organize and deploy MATS staff and managers to promptly and efficiently evaluate promising candidates. Prior background with artificial intelligence safety is a plus, but is definitely not required – we will primarily rely on you to be an expert at designing and implementing a high‑quality hiring pipeline and process. We will rely primarily on other MATS staff to decide whether specific candidates have the necessary technical skills and are adequately aligned with MATS’s mission. Show your work: You will build the infrastructure that makes hiring systematic and visible: a live pipeline dashboard, regular reporting on time‑to‑hire and conversion rates, and recurring sourcing loops for our most common roles. Success means that roles get filled on time with high‑quality hires and that leadership can accurately predict how many staff will be available. Give every candidate a professional experience: You will be the first and most frequent point of contact applicants have with MATS. We’ll count on you to make sure candidates have a professional experience – you’ll be in charge of making sure that their interviews are scheduled promptly, that they receive appropriate feedback, and that candidates receive reasonable accommodations for their particular needs. We’ll purchase and support the use of state‑of‑the‑art tools to streamline scheduling, but we’ll need you to provide a human touch.
